Hsu Li-Lan Kuo Feifei Li In this interview, Jason Hsu , Co-Founder and Vice Chairman at Research Affiliates , discusses the unique characteristics of low-beta stocks. He identifies popular strategies for constructing low-volatility portfolios, evaluates their performance and suggests key issues for further research. Hsu, also an Adjunct Professor in Finance at UCLA’s Anderson School of Management , and his co-authors present their full research findings in A Study of Low-Volatility Portfolio Construction Methods , published in The Journal of Portfolio Management .Some of the actionable items you will read about include: Know the source of returns. Anticipate highly concentrated positions. Keep a sharp eye on valuations.
